Side gables are one of the most common and also simple design of gable roofing, with 2 sides pitched to develop a triangle. If a side gable roofing is exposed between it is referred to as an open saddleback roof, or closed in for a boxed gable roofing. Crossed saddleback roofs are 2 gable roof areas integrated perpendicularly or at an appropriate angle; they are typically seen on Cape Cod or Tudor-style homes.

A front gable roofing system is generally seen on Colonial-style houses, and it is placed at the front to highlight the entry and include protection to the patio or entranceway. Last but not least, a Dutch gable roofing system or gablet roofing is a mix of a hip roofing system and also a gable design roof covering that includes adding a gable to a hip roof covering to add interest to the residence's style and provide some additional attic space under the roof covering.




These variants on fundamental gable roofs Dutch, crossed, and front gables can be actual standouts if a mix of shades or perhaps numerous sorts of roof products are used in order to display the different attributes. What is a Saltbox Roof covering? Saltbox roof coverings are typically discovered on earlier Colonial or Cape Cod-style houses, and they are defined by their distinct asymmetrical design.


Initially, this style of roofing system developed naturally when early inhabitants in the Northeast and also East shores of the united state included a lean-to in addition to their existing gabled roof coverings, which provided more room as well as called for little added structure material. After that type of framework came to be preferred, it became usual to develop residences keeping that sort of roofing already included since it adds another story or fifty percent tale of room to your home's structure.




You Home Page can utilize most of the basic roof products such as asphalt shingles, steel tiles, wood or cedar shingles or shakes, slate, or composite shingles to develop a saltbox roofing. Every one of that claimed, maintain in mind that the living space under this type of roof might have slanted ceilings and be much less roomy than the space that is supplied by other styles of roofing system.


What is a Butterfly Roof covering? This is a type of roofing system that is v-shaped with 2 elevated wings that meet in a valley between just like a butterfly that is mid-flight. Butterfly roofs can have a dramatic impact and they are a good choice for residences with contemporary designing as well as for homes in arid or desert climates since the valley in the center permits rainwater to be gathered (there is normally a tank for this purpose integrated right into the layout.
